Output 45734d1a8f105fa19feec1a83552d2eb687f250069d3788275b1ceaf77e218ff:21

value
519037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9e4b63a73b5768c787d296b3cf46a103ca1d84 OP_EQUAL
address
3HhbocDcHiNjMLb3JK3dQGG2Ta17GgqkVp
transaction
45734d1a8f105fa19feec1a83552d2eb687f250069d3788275b1ceaf77e218ff
spent
true